I find that it's a real crap shoot as far as shipping stuff over from the US. However it mostly depends on who the courier is. FedEx is pretty good and hardly ever charges duty, etc. Even USPS is pretty good although sometimes you get dinged with Canada Post. The worst is UPS. I will never order from anyone who can't make a deal with me to ship with someone else. As an example, I ordered a mirror from Quadratech (69.99 + 10.00 for shipping). UPS charged me $40 for 'brokerage fees'. Sorry but they're the only ones who do that so that's bull-hockey!!!
